Aspirus Health hosts welcome celebration at Sacred Heart Hospital

By Jalen Maki
September 15, 2021
366
0
Share:

For the Tomahawk Leader

TOMAHAWK – Sacred Heart Hospital in Tomahawk was one of seven hospital locations to formally celebrate joining Aspirus Health during a welcome event held on Tuesday, Sept. 14.

Hospital and Clinic leaders joined with employees and community partners as part of a system-wide celebration for the seven hospitals, 21 clinics, air and ground transport services and 2,700 employees who became part of the Aspirus system on Aug. 1.

“It has been nearly six weeks since the Sacred Heart team joined Aspirus, and we are all very excited and optimistic about what this transition offers our patients, our hospital, our staff, and our community,” said Laurie Oungst, Vice President and Chief Administrative Officer at Sacred Heart. “For decades, this hospital has been caring for Tomahawk and its neighboring communities. Generations of families have entrusted their health-and their lives-to the medical professionals here.”

Leaders at Sacred Heart Hospital concluded the event with a tree planting ceremony “to serve as a symbol of the commitment to grow and thrive with the Tomahawk community,” Aspirus Health said. Photos courtesy of Aspirus Health.

Aspirus Health said the name of Sacred Heart and the former Ascension Wisconsin clinics serving the area will remain the same for the immediate future, although on site signs now indicate that they have joined Aspirus Health. Ultimately, facility names will be changed to reflect the Aspirus brand. By Dec. 2021, all signs and materials will reflect the new Aspirus facility names.

Tomahawk mayor Steven E. Taskay speaks at the celebration ceremony.

“The event concluded with a tree planting ceremony to serve as a symbol of the commitment to grow and thrive with the Tomahawk community,” Aspirus Health said “The tree was planted with 10 symbolic jars of soil, representing the 10 legacy Aspirus hospitals welcoming the 7 new hospitals to the Aspirus Health family.”
